Gary Windass is hiding something major in Coronation Street, and fans believe they have rumbled exactly what it is. Contrary to initial suspicions, it is not an affair or murder. The evil Theo Silverton (James Cartwright) was killed off earlier this year after his abusive crimes were exposed, sparking a whodunnit on the ITV soap. He was found dead during Murder Week, with suspects including Todd Grimshaw, Christina Boyd, George Shuttleworth, Summer Spellman, Gary Windass, and Danielle Silverton.

Gary and Sarah's Secret

Although Summer has been charged with Theo's murder, Gary and ex-girlfriend Sarah Platt (Tina O'Brien) appear to be covering something up. Last week, Gary admitted the secret was taking a toll, telling Sarah he 'doesn't know how much more he can take' and 'can't do this anymore'. Fans have shared theories online, from a one-night stand to Gary being the killer. However, a new theory suggests neither of them actually murdered Theo.

Fan Theories Emerge

Viewers suspect Sarah and Gary merely had a 'scuffle' with Theo on the night he was murdered, and the real killer remains at large. One fan on a Coronation Street Facebook page mused: 'I think maybe Sarah had a scuffle with Theo, Gary saved her, neither of them killed him, but they know how it would look if anyone knew anything.' Another agreed: 'I don't think it was them.' A third added: 'It's nothing to do with an affair and I don't think they killed Theo either. Probably just saw him the night he was murdered.' Another fan suggested: 'I reckon Gary attacked Theo and thinks he killed him and ran off, but Theo wasn't actually dead, and someone else finished him off, but Gary didn't see the second person so he thinks he did it.'
